You should never attempt any kind of ROM update on a pocket pc without having the Pocket PC directly plugged into AC power.

Try the procedure again. This time, plug the USB cable directly into a USB port on the computer (don't use a USB hub), plug the Pocket PC directly into AC power, turn off all power saving options on your computer, remove any installed storage cards from the Pocket PC, and disable your computer's firewall. Also, be sure you are running the upgrade from an XP computer (Vista is not compatible). Hopefully, you have not bricked your device.
